About the course
This blended course is ideal for many workplaces where 2-day face-to-face training courses are more challenging for course participant attendance.
There are two components to the Blended Online MHFA Course:
- A self-paced eLearning component (takes 5-7 hours to complete)
- An instructor-led component using ZOOM (2 sessions of 2.5 hours each including set-up time).
The training will cover:
- Depression and anxiety
- Psychosis
- Substance use problems
As how to handle:
- Suicidal thoughts and behaviours
- Panic attacks
- Traumatic events
- Severe psychotic states
- Severe effects from alcohol or other drug use
- Aggressive behaviours.
